MORENO VALLEY, Calif. - The Bureau of Land Management (BLM) has published a Notice of Intent (NOI) to conduct an environmental review for the Ocotillo Wells Recreation Area in Imperial County.
The BLM will prepare an environmental impact statement to analyze the efficiency and effectiveness of resource and recreation management at the Ocotillo Wells State Vehicular Recreation Area (SVRA) and a proposed amendment to the BLM California Desert Conservation Area (CDCA) Plan. The California State Parks, who manage the SVRA through a Memorandum of Understanding, will jointly prepare an environmental impact report for their General Plan update.
Publication of the Notice of Intent initiates a public scoping period which will end April 6, 2015. During the scoping period, the BLM will solicit public comments on planning issues, environmental concerns, potential impacts, alternatives, and mitigation measures that should be included in the analysis of the proposed action.
